Proposal
The change of use and conversion of the existing offices to residential (Use Class C3) at Kender Housing Office 287 Queens Road SE15, comprising 2 one bedroom, 4 two bedroom and 2 three bedroom self-contained flats, together with alterations to the elevations and the provision of 10 car parking spaces and 8 cycle spaces.

About full applications
A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
